NAME
   DateTimeX::Format::Ago - I should have written this module "3 years ago"

SYNOPSIS
     my $then = DateTime->now->subtract(days => 3);
     say DateTimeX::Format::Ago->format_datetime($then); # "3 days ago"

DESCRIPTION
   Ever wished DateTime::Format::Natural had a `format_datetime` method? This
   module provides human-friendly datetime formatting, outputting strings
   like "3 days ago".

   Primary use case: websites that show a list of a person's recent
   activities.

 Constructor
   `new(language => $lang)`
       Creates a formatter object for the given language (a BCP47 language
       code). If the language is omitted, extracts it from $ENV{LANG}.

       Decent English ('en'), German ('de'), French ('fr'), Portuguese
       ('pt'), Korean ('ko'), and Indonesian ('id') support is provided.
       Castillian Spanish ('es') is also provided, but some of the strings
       were translated with Google Translate, so they might not be perfect.

 Methods
   `format_datetime($dt)`
       Returns something like "3 days ago", "just now" or "hace un año".

   `parse_datetime($string)`
       Croaks. Don't use this.

BUGS AND LIMITATIONS
 High resolution datetimes
   Imagine the time is currently 2020-01-01T12:00:00.200. If you try to
   format the time 2020-01-01T12:00:00.100 you'll get back the result "in the
   future". So what's going on? DateTimeX::Format::Ago figures out when "now"
   is using `DateTime->now`, which rounds back to the nearest whole second.

   If you know you're going to be dealing with high resolution datetimes, and
   don't want to occasionally see "in the future" for times in the very
   recent past, then use Time::HiRes.

    use Time::HiRes qw();

   That's all you need to do. Merely loading it will give
   DateTimeX::Format::Ago an indication that you want it to use a more
   accurate idea of "now".
